Corporal punishment is not the right way to punish children because it is humiliating and will add more bullying to schools. “Children who experience corporal punishment are more likely to hit or use other violence against other students or people(Anastasia 3)” When an administrator or someone kids look up to does someone thing, it makes the thing they do seem ok to their pupils. When teachers hit their students the children will pick up from that thinking it is ok to use violence against other people as well. Some people think that it is ok because it teaches students to express their anger through violence, but this will lead to children being violent against each other. This will cause much more bullying because the children will start to hit each other. Also some children think that it is funny to see other people in pain, so they will laugh or even beat up the children who were hit by their teachers or administrators.
